• 0 رای - 0 میانگین
  • 1
  • 2
  • 3
  • 4
  • 5
ایجاد نظر سنجی
#1
سلام و باعرض خسته نباشید
من یک پروژه درست کردم و الان گیر همینم
ایجاد یک نظر سنجی در Dreamweaver با PHP
چطوری باید اینو درست کنم.
من تازه کارم اگر میشه کامل توضیح بدید.
ممنونHuh
  پاسخ
تشکر شده توسط :
#2
https://www.google.com/search?q=how+to+c...channel=fs
غایب
  پاسخ
تشکر شده توسط : Reza robiniho_664 hamid_80386
#3
من خودم یک نظرسنجی ساده بدون jquery درست کردم که خیلی دوستش دارم . اگه میخواید مراحلش رو میگم . ولی اول شما باید یک جدول برای همین کار تو پایگاه بسازید.
مثلا اسمش رو بزارید opinion و شامل این فیلدها باشه :
excellent,good,meduim,bad از نوع varchar10 مثلا . این مرحله رو انجام دادید؟
آرام باش ؛ توكل كن ؛ تفكر كن و سپس آستينها را بالا بزن , آنگاه دستان خداوند را خواهي ديد كه زودتر از تو دست به كار شده است.امام علي عليه السلام.
  پاسخ
تشکر شده توسط : Reza undefined
#4
(۱۳۹۱ مرداد ۰۳, ۰۴:۲۸ ب.ظ)pary_daryayi نوشته: من خودم یک نظرسنجی ساده بدون jquery درست کردم که خیلی دوستش دارم . اگه میخواید مراحلش رو میگم . ولی اول شما باید یک جدول برای همین کار تو پایگاه بسازید.
مثلا اسمش رو بزارید opinion و شامل این فیلدها باشه :
excellent,good,meduim,bad از نوع varchar10 مثلا . این مرحله رو انجام دادید؟

آره
  پاسخ
تشکر شده توسط :
#5
روش معمول برای ایجاد نظرسنجی استفاده از دو جدوله...
جدول اول سوال نظرسنجی رو توی خودش نگه می داره.
جدول دوم گزینه های نظرسنجی بهمراه مقادیرشون و آی دی نظرسنجی...
چون گزینه ها باید پویا باشه دیگه...ممکنه یه نظرسنجی ۴تا گزینه داشته باشه.یه نظرسنجی ۲تا یه نظر سنجی هم ۱۰تا.
بنده طعم ايمان را نمي چشد، تا اينكه دريابد آنچه اتفاق نيفتاده است نمي شد كه اتفاق بيفتد؛و آنچه شده و اتفاق افتاده است,نمي شد كه نشود و اتفاق نيفتد....حضرت علي(ع)
  پاسخ
#6
Dreamweaver هیچ ارتباطی با PHP نداره. Sleepy
  پاسخ
تشکر شده توسط : undefined
#7
نقل قول:چون گزینه ها باید پویا باشه دیگه...ممکنه یه نظرسنجی ۴تا گزینه داشته باشه.یه نظرسنجی ۲تا یه نظر سنجی هم ۱۰تا.
من متوجه منظور شما نشدم . مگه نظرسنجی در مورد سایت منظور همون گزینه های عالی ، خوب، متوسط و بد نیست .
اینطور یک جدول لازمه دیگه . یه مثال لطف میکنید در این مورد ...
آرام باش ؛ توكل كن ؛ تفكر كن و سپس آستينها را بالا بزن , آنگاه دستان خداوند را خواهي ديد كه زودتر از تو دست به كار شده است.امام علي عليه السلام.
  پاسخ
تشکر شده توسط :
#8
(۱۳۹۱ مرداد ۰۳, ۰۸:۵۲ ب.ظ)pary_daryayi نوشته:
نقل قول:چون گزینه ها باید پویا باشه دیگه...ممکنه یه نظرسنجی ۴تا گزینه داشته باشه.یه نظرسنجی ۲تا یه نظر سنجی هم ۱۰تا.
من متوجه منظور شما نشدم . مگه نظرسنجی در مورد سایت منظور همون گزینه های عالی ، خوب، متوسط و بد نیست .
اینطور یک جدول لازمه دیگه . یه مثال لطف میکنید در این مورد ...

نه ببین اینی که شما میگی واسه ساختن یه مدل استاتیک هست، نه یه شیء نظر سنجی، اینطوری فقط یه مدل نظر سنجی میتونی بسازی...

فکر کن یکی یه کامپوننت بخواد واسه ساختن رأی گیری
مثلاً یه نظر سنجی میزاره به این صورت:

اعراب را چکار کنیم؟ :
الف: در خلیج فارس خف کنیم
ب: سوسمار مهمانشون کنیم
ج: ولشون کنیم به حال خودشون خوش باشن

و یکی دیگه به اینصورت:

نام خلیج جنوبی ایران چیست؟
الف: خلیج پارس
ب: خلیج همیشه پارس
ج: خلیج عرب بی عرب، فقط پارس

اینطوری یا باید دو بار با روش خودتون دو تا جدول بسازین عین هم و با یه ساختار

یا اینکه دو تا جدول به شکل زیر بسازید و هزار مدل رأی گیری از توش در بیارید:

جدول متن نظر سنجی - فیلدها:

ID
Text

جدول گزینه های نظر سنجی:

ID (که باید ID مرتبط با رکورد متن نظر سنجی توش ثبت بشه)
text
NumOfRate (هر بار که به این گزینه رأی بدن این گزینه فیلد پیدا میکند)

- به ازای هر گزینه برای نظر سنجی یه رکورد تو این جدول ثبت میشه
---------------------------------

مثال:

   
هر که با مرغ هوا دوست شود - خوابش آرامترین خواب جهان خواهد بود.
  پاسخ
تشکر شده توسط : pary_daryayi undefined javafa
#9
بعد یه آپشن دیگه ام باید لحاظ بشه ، اینکه یک کاربر فقط میتونه یک رای بده ! (آی پی و یوزر ایجنت رای دهنده ذخیره بشه !)
توی phpkode.com فکر کنم مثالهای خوبی پیدا کنین .
وبلاگ rezaonline.net/blog
سفارش برنامه نویسی reza.biz
Php , mysql , postgresql , redis , Yii and ... Cool
  پاسخ
تشکر شده توسط : hamid_80386
#10
فعلا بحث یک رای دادن رو بذاریم کنار....
ببینین اینجوری مثال میزنم....
شما مثلا یه نظرسنجی میذارین با این عنوان:
مطالب این سایت را چطور ارزیابی میکنین:4تا گزینه داره.
1-عالی
2-خوب
3-متوسط
4-ضعیف


بعد ممکنه یه نظرسنجی بذارین مثلا با این عنوان: آیا شما با اضافه شدن انجمن گفتگو به این سایت موافق هستید؟ 2تا گزینه داره.
1-بلی
2-خیر


بعد مثلا ممکنه از این نظرسنجی یه جای دیگه هم استفاده کنین....مثلا به نظر شما در انتخابات ریاست جمهوری آینده چه کسی رای می آورد؟
1-سعید جلیلی
2-قالیباف
3-لاریجانی
4-محسن رضایی
5-محمدرضا عارف
6-اسحاق جهانگیری
7-کامران باقری لنکرانی


میبینین؟یه دونه سوال داریم....اما به ازای هر سوال نظرسنجی ممکنه گزینه هامون تعدادشون فرق کنه...اولی 4تا داشت. دومی 2تا ، سومی 7تا....
واسه همین یه جدول ایجاد میکنین که حداقل شامل فیلد آی دی ، و عنوان سوال باشه
و یه جدول دیگه هم حداقل شامل آی دی ، آی دی سوال نظرسنجی، عنوان گزینه جواب، و تعداد آرای اون جواب.
بنده طعم ايمان را نمي چشد، تا اينكه دريابد آنچه اتفاق نيفتاده است نمي شد كه اتفاق بيفتد؛و آنچه شده و اتفاق افتاده است,نمي شد كه نشود و اتفاق نيفتد....حضرت علي(ع)
  پاسخ
تشکر شده توسط : pary_daryayi


پرش به انجمن:


کاربران در حال بازدید این موضوع: 1 مهمان